Calculate how much oxygen should be used to burn 0.1 mol of aluminum?

Metallic aluminum reacts with oxygen to form alumina. The reaction is described by the following chemical reaction equation:

4Al + 3O2 = 2Al2O3;

N Al = 0.1 mol;

When burning aluminum for 1 mol of metal, it is necessary to take ¾ = 0.75 mol of oxygen. Let’s calculate its volume.

To do this, multiply the amount of oxygen by the volume of 1 mole of gas (filling volume 22.4 liters).

N O2 = 0.1 / 4 x 3 = 0.075 mol;

V O2 = 0.075 x 22.4 = 1.68 liters;
